Financial aid and scholarships

Financial Aid is awarded on a first-come, first-served basis to families with demonstrated financial need. Pre-College Programs operate independently of the University’s Financial Aid Office. We do not guarantee that all eligible applicants will receive aid.

Rochester Scholars Scholarship

The School of Arts & Sciences Dean’s Office provides scholarships for students who attend the Rochester City School District. Contact our office to learn more about eligibility.

Pre-college summer courses give you a sneak peek at campus life

Since the summer courses began in 1990, URochester has welcomed thousands of high school students to campus—from Los Angeles to New York, but also Bangladesh to Brazil, Morocco to South Korea, and Venezuela to Vietnam.

It’s a chance to preview your future—and discover your path.
